Vara De Tarea

La vara de tarea is a Spanish colonial unit de longueur utilisé en parts of Latin America, particulièrement associated with agricultural land measurement. Il est a variant of the vara, a traditional Iberian unit whose length varied by region, typiquement ranging between 0.8 and 0.9 meters. The vara de tarea was used spécifiquement in the context of assigning agricultural work tasks, où a tarea represented the area a worker could cultivate in a day. 


mètre

La metre (Commonwealth spelling and BIPM spelling) or meter (American spelling) (from the French unit mètre, from the Greek noun μετρούν, "measure") is the unité de base de longueur dans le Système international d'unités (SI) (SI). The unité SI symbol is m. Le mètre est défini comme the length of the path travelled by light in a vacuum in 1/299,792,458 of a second.

Le mètre was à l'origine defined in 1793 as one ten-millionth of the distance from the equator to the North Pole along a great circle, so the Earth's circumference is approximativement 40000 km. In 1799, the metre was redefined in terms of a prototype metre bar (the actual bar used was changed in 1889). In 1960, the metre was redefined in terms of a certain number of wavelengths of a certain emission line of krypton-86. In 1983, the current definition a été adopté.
